MOL - Resource Services Case Study

Individual experts for multiple domains and professional functions.

About MOL Group

MOL Group is a leading integrated oil and gas company based in Hungary, operating across exploration, production, refining, and retail in Central and Eastern Europe. It plays a key role in the region’s energy supply while also investing in sustainable technologies and alternative energy solutions.

Capture has been supporting MOL with resource services since 2016, in short, medium and long term projects. We also got involved in their non-SAP test methodology development endeavour and providing development services for a wholesale platform.

 

Capture references with MOL

  • Senior Project Managers in:
    • Retail
    • Downstream
    • Infrastructure
  • Business Analysts
  • Developer

 

7+ YEARS OF COLLABORATION

  • 40+ PROJECTS
  • Topics include: Card system  replacement, electronic chargers, MOL Limo, SAP ERP, International acquisition program.
  • Budapest, Slovakia, Slovenia, Romania, Poland: On-site and hybrid services for regional projects.
